On a warm Saturday evening in Tampa, England moved through the final motions of preparation before the World Cup, dispatching New Zealand 1-0 in a match that asked little and revealed less. Harry Kane, ever the captain's captain, provided the decisive header just past halftime — a goal that was less about inspiration than about the quiet reassurance a team needs before the storm. These are the rituals of readiness: not glory, but the steady confirmation that the machinery is in order.
